Patent number: 5235348Abstract: A housing for a light emitting diode recording head used for linewise recording information on a photoreceptor in a recording apparatus is constituted by elongated extrusion molded base and cover sections held together in a unitary structure by injection molded and closure members. The cover section has opposed inclined side walls engaged at their diverging margins on the base section and defining at their converging margins an elongated slot for receiving the lens array of the head. Preferably, the cover section is formed of two identical subsections with their converging margins held apart by an inner leg on each end member to define said slot. The end members and/or the ends of the base section can carry projections to facilitate accurate mounting of the head in the apparatus. The inner surfaces of the cover section can be contoured to provide sealing surfaces for cooperation with a sealing bead of resilient material surrounding the electrical components within the head.Type: GrantFiled: June 28, 1991Date of Patent: August 10, 1993Assignee: AGFA-Gevaert N. Patent number: 5233413Abstract: A colored original is scanned point-by-point and density values are generated for each point in the primary colors red, green and blue. The points are divided into groups and the density values for each primary color are averaged over the respective groups. The averaged density values for each group are transformed into a set of converted values including a luminance value as well as first and second chrominance values. The range spanned by the luminance values is divided into segments and each set is assigned to a respective segment. The sets are classified as color dominant or color nondominant by comparing the saturation value of each set with a threshold value. For each, segment the first and second chrominance values of the nondominant sets are respectively added to yield first and second sums. The first and second sums are shifted relative to the gray point to generate corrected first and second sums.Type: GrantFiled: January 9, 1991Date of Patent: August 3, 1993Assignee: Agfa-Gevaert AktiengesellschaftInventor: Hermann Fuchsberger

Patent number: 5223882Abstract: A tank for wet treatment of a running web of photosensitive material has a set of upper pulleys and a set of lower pulleys mounted on a common support and movable up and down toward and away from the upper pulleys. The web is alternatingly trained over the upper and lower pulleys to advance along a meandering portion of its path from a first drive at the inlet into the body of liquid in the tank to a computer-controlled second drive at the locus of emergence of the web from the body of liquid. At least one additional drive is provided for one or more median upper pulleys to thus reduce the tensional stress upon the repeatedly looped running web. The additional drive can employ a capacitor motor, a d-c motor, a hysteresis motor or clutch, a pneumatic motor or a hydraulic motor. Such additional drive can rotate the respective upper pulley at a constant speed or at a speed which varies as a function of changes in the speed of advancement of the web through the body of liquid.Type: GrantFiled: June 3, 1992Date of Patent: June 29, 1993Assignee: Agfa-Gevaert AktiengesellschaftInventor: Lutz Beckmann

Patent number: 5216521Abstract: A colored photographic original is scanned at a multiplicity of points in each of the primary colors red, green and blue to generate a set of image signals for each primary color. The average luminance of the original in each primary color is calculated from the radiation used for scanning and respective first correction signals for scattered light arising during scanning are produced from the average luminances. The correction signal for each primary color is subtracted from each image signal of the corresponding set. The corrected image signals are processed to enhance the image carried by the signals. The processed signals are sent to a printer. Furthermore, the processed signals of each set are averaged and the resulting averages used to produce respective second correction signals for scattered light arising during printing. The second correction signal for each primary color is subtracted from each processed signal of the corresponding set.Type: GrantFiled: January 15, 1991Date of Patent: June 1, 1993Assignee: Agfa-Gevaert AktiengesellschaftInventor: Klaus Birgmeir
